PLK1 (polo-like kinase 1) is a member of the serine/threonine protein kinase family, cdc5/polo subfamily.
PLK1 contains two polo box domains with a predicted molecular weight of 68 kDa.
PLK1 has been shown to regulate cdc2/cyclin B through phosphorylation and activation of cdc25c phosphatase.
PLK1 is modified by phosphorylation at Threonine 210.
PLK1 may also be required for cell division.
Depletion of PLK1 results in apoptosis and deregulation of expression of PKL1 is correlated with development of many malignancies.
